Dreamliner Disaster: Experts examine what could have gone wrong

According to officials aware of the matter, a Mayday call was issued by the pilots shortly after take-off

The Boeing 787 aircraft that crashed soon after taking off — it spent all of 33 seconds in the air — from Ahmedabad’s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el International Airport has left the aviation industry stunned, with experts examining what could have gone wrong with the 11-year-old aircraft carrying 230 passengers and 12 crew.
